Concacaf Gold Cup History
Since its inception in 1991, the Concacaf Gold Cup has grown into the most prestigious soccer tournament in the region, consistently delivering high-stakes drama and showcasing the rising talent of North America, Central America, and the Caribbean. The 2025 Concacaf Gold Cup, co-hosted by the United States and Canada, will see matches played in iconic venues such as SoFi Stadium, PayPal Park in San Jose, CA, and Allegiant Stadium in Las Vegas, NV, bringing the excitement of the gold cup to fans across the Western United States.
The tournament’s format features four groups of four teams each, with the group stage determining which teams advance. The top two teams from each group—the four group winners and four runners-up—move on to the knockout stage, where every match is a do-or-die battle for a place in the final. The path to the championship includes a thrilling semifinal match at Levi’s Stadium in Santa Clara, culminating in the final showdown at NRG Stadium in Houston, TX.
Qualification for the Concacaf Gold Cup is closely linked to the Concacaf Nations League, which helps determine the participating teams. Snapdragon Stadium San Diego
Snapdragon Stadium, located at 2101 Stadium Way, stadium San Diego, CA, is the chosen venue for these exciting matches. With a seating capacity of approximately 35,000, the stadium offers an intimate yet electrifying atmosphere for fans to enjoy the games.
Every seat in this state-of-the-art facility offers a great view, making it an ideal setting for the prestigious tournament.
Group Stage Matches in San Diego
On June 15, 2025, San Diego will host two highly anticipated group stage matches at Snapdragon Stadium. The first match will see Haiti face off against Saudi Arabia, and in the second match, Costa Rica will take on Suriname.

Top Tourist Attractions
Balboa Park is a must-visit, featuring museums, gardens, and breathtaking parks. La Jolla Cove offers picturesque views and opportunities for snorkeling and kayaking, while the San Diego Zoo is renowned for its extensive wildlife and natural habitats.
For those who enjoy hiking, Torrey Pines State Natural Reserve provides scenic trails with breathtaking ocean vistas.

The 2025 Concacaf Gold Cup will be held across 14 stadiums in 11 metropolitan areas in the United States and Canada, marking a significant milestone in the tournament's history. The competition will feature 16 teams and take place from June 14 to July 6, 2025. Notably, the final match is scheduled for NRG Stadium in Houston, Texas, which will host the Gold Cup final for a record eighth time.
Among the host venues, three are making their Gold Cup debut: U.S. Bank Stadium in Minneapolis, PayPal Park in San Jose, and BC Place in Vancouver . Other prominent stadiums include SoFi Stadium in Inglewood, State Farm Stadium in Glendale, and Allegiant Stadium in Las Vegas. The tournament's group stage will run from June 14 to 24, followed by the knockout rounds leading up to the final on July 6.
